I used this month’s sketch to make 30 (yes 30) spring themed mini-slimline cards. I pulled in some paper from a Michael’s hot buy paper pad (In Bloom) I had in my stash. I started by cutting all the patterned paper since I planned on doing this assembly line style. I then cut out my card bases and the sentiment strips. I used several stamp sets by Simon Says Stamp (Birthday Flowers, See You Soon, Wake Up & Make Up, Sympathy Greetings, Hello Sunshine, Amazing) and stamped all my sentiment strips ahead of time. I also brought in some enamel dots I found at Dollar Tree that matched the spring color theme perfectly. Now that I had all my elements ready to go, it was just a matter of assembling all the cards.
